Corporate Associate | Elite US Law Firm | London
London | Competitive US Market Compensation | Private Equity & M&A
An exceptional opportunity has arisen for a talented Corporate Associate to join the London office of a leading international law firm with a market-leading Corporate and Financial Sponsors practice.
Working alongside highly regarded partners, you'll advise leading private equity sponsors, portfolio companies and corporate clients on some of the most sophisticated domestic and cross-border transactions in the market. The team is known for its high-quality work, lean deal teams and genuine responsibility from an early stage.

The Role
You will advise on a broad range of matters including:
- Private equity acquisitions and disposals
- Cross-border M&A transactions
- Auction processes
- Portfolio company investments and exits
- Corporate restructurings and general corporate advisory work
About You
Applications are welcomed from England & Wales qualified solicitors with:
- Approximately 1-6 years' PQE
- Strong corporate M&A experience gained at a leading City, US or international law firm
- Financial Sponsors and private equity transaction experience
- Excellent technical ability and commercial awareness
- Strong academics and a collaborative approach
